Polworth Square is in Sunderland and in Sunderland district. SR3 1QJ is located in the Silksworth elect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Houghton and Sunderland South.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ding SR3 1QJ,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 54.3%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around SR3 1QJ,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 61.8%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

Safety

Is Polworth Square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Polworth Square was 114.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 42.2% higher than the Barnes average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Polworth Square has the 29th highest crime rate of 106 local areas in Barnes and the 252nd highest crime rate of 922 local areas in Sunderland .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 65.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-70.6%.
